What is Veraq?
Veraq is an open, verifiable platform for community prosperity. Participation runs in waves, every participation and outcome is written to an open record anyone can inspect, and a defined share of every outcome flows to verified causes participants choose.
How do I know it is fair?
The mechanism that decides each wave, commit-reveal-v1, is committed to the open record before the wave runs and provable after it ends. You can read the math first and check the outcome against it later, rather than trust a process you cannot open.
What is the open record?
The open record is the public, auditable account of what happens on Veraq: each wave, its committed mechanism, the participations, the outcomes, and the contributions to causes. Every entry links to the next, so a wave can be followed end to end, before and after it runs.
What is a wave?
A wave is a single round of participation. Its mechanism is published before the wave opens, participants take part on terms they can see, and the result is revealed and recorded when the wave closes.
How does the share to causes work?
A defined, published share of every outcome is allocated automatically to verified causes that participants help choose, and each contribution is written to the open record. The share is structural and consistent, so you can follow exactly where it went, from outcome to cause.
Are outcomes promised in advance?
No. Veraq is for shared opportunity, not an assured result, and no outcome is ever promised. What is fixed is that the mechanism is published in advance, the record is open, and the defined share reaches verified causes.

How do I verify a wave?
Open the record entry for the wave, read the committed mechanism, then confirm the revealed values and outcome resolve from that commitment. The how-it-works and open-record pages walk through each step, and the published references let you reproduce the check yourself.
